Frozen Red Raspberries Thawed and Packed in Syrup from China

Red raspberries initially frozen then thawed, preserved in sugar syrup tins for year-round use. HTS 2008.99.2120 covers such prepared red raspberries not fitting fresh, frozen, or juice categories. Added sugar qualifies as 'with added sweetening matter'.

Import Tips

Document heat processing post-thaw to prove preservation, avoiding frozen fruit classification

Include lab analysis of sugar content and pH for CBP review
